Output e70620f95f87316744108de819a01b3c85f60193ef4e547743cc42ab78906b62:0

value
190740
script pubkey
OP_0 OP_PUSHBYTES_32 56f32bf6c7285a2ec412fbfc5b3f4fcc910edb9a0c5989c5f495f4e0310fafeb
address
bc1q2mejhak89pdza3qjl079k060ejgsaku6p3vcn305jh6wqvg04l4ssu9rwn
transaction
e70620f95f87316744108de819a01b3c85f60193ef4e547743cc42ab78906b62
confirmations
165939
spent
true